Transaction 72a64c156133f2ef49485e700902d388dfe17862b825be135274a474df49cb03

2 Input
2 Outputs
  • 72a64c156133f2ef49485e700902d388dfe17862b825be135274a474df49cb03:0
  • value  8733084
    address  3HUPxokrcHfaHR2WDc5tpPAifkknNJqyVA
  • 72a64c156133f2ef49485e700902d388dfe17862b825be135274a474df49cb03:1
  • value  1179267
    address  39953ncYhZvWkfeo1hLzdcS9b1oPx6PjRc